County officers of each county may organize for themselves a State association as follows: (1) County commissioners, with the county solicitor, the chief clerk to the county commissioners and officers who are counterpart personnel in counties having a home rule charter or optional form of government. (2) County controllers. (3) Sheriffs. (4) District attorneys. (5) Probation officers. (6) Registers of wills and clerks of orphans' courts. (7) Prothonotaries and clerks of courts. (8) County treasurers. (9) Recorders of deeds. (10) Directors of veterans' affairs. (11) Coroners. (12) Jury commissioners. (13) County auditors. (14) Public defenders.
